Title: POLYNESIAN KABOBS
Categories: Appetizers, Pork
Yield: 1 Servings
20.00 oz Pineapple Chunks In Syrup
6.00 tb Soy Sauce
3.00 tb Honey
1.00 tb Dry Sherry
1.00 ts Grated Orange Peel
0.13 ts Garlic Powder
2.00 lb Cooked Ham, Cut Into 25
-Cubes (1 Inch)
1.00 lb Thick Sliced Bacon
25.00 lg Stuffed Olives
25.00 Cherry Tomatoes
Drain pineapple; reserve syrup. Blend syrup, soy sauce, honey,
sherry, orange peel and garlic powder in large bowl; stir in ham
cubes. Cover; refrigerate 1 hour, stirring occasionally. Cut each
bacon slice crosswise in half; wrap pineapple chunks with halved
bacon slices. Thread bamboo or metal skewers with a wrapped pineapple
chunk, an olive, another wrapped pineapple chunk, a marinated ham
cube and a cherry tomato. Place skewers on rack of broiler pan; brush
with marinade. Broil 3 to 4 minutes on each side, or until bacon is
crisp. Typed by Syd Bigger.
